4 Things to Consider Before Hiring Residential Electrical Contractors

Construction Worker Planning Contractor Developer Concept

According to the Electrical Foundation International, about 51,000 home electrical fires happen every year. They result in about 500 deaths and damage of about $1 billion.

This data presents residential electrical contractors as a necessity. They are the professionals who can help keep your home safe from electrical fires.

But with over 70,000 electrical contracting firms to choose from, how do you know which one is right for your needs? Here are five things to consider before you hire an electrician.

1. Experience

Residential electricians are responsible for a residential project’s success.

You can’t expect them to perform well if they don’t have the experience needed to fulfill their duties. For example, an electrical contractor with only one year of experience is less likely than one with five years of experience to make your home safer using residential electrical services such as installing wiring and lighting fixtures.

Hiring residential electrical contractors without enough experience will limit you from getting the most out of your money’s worth. They might not provide quality workmanship or may even create more problems because they’re still learning how things work in the industry.

2. Licensing and Insurance

All residential electrical contractors should be licensed and insured. This protects you in case something goes wrong.

Make sure to ask to see the contractor’s license and insurance policy. You want to ensure that they are licensed in your state and that their insurance is up-to-date.

If something does go wrong, you’ll want to know that you’re covered financially. A licensed electrician means they are following building codes and safety regulations.

It also shows that they take their work seriously enough to get licensed. And having insurance protects both you and the contractor if an accident happens on your property.

3. References

A good residential electrical contractor will provide references from happy customers. Ask the contractor for a list of references and call them.

Talk to people who have used the contractor’s services in the past. Find out if they were happy with the work done, if there were any problems, and how well the contractor communicated with them.

References are a great way to get an idea of what working with a residential electrician is like. They can also give you an idea of what kind of work this contractor does well and which areas they need improvement in.

If the contractor refuses to give you references or tries to dodge your questions, it’s best to move on.

4. Reputation

A residential electrical contractor’s reputation is everything. It’s important to find out what others think of the residential electrician before hiring them.

Look for reviews online or ask around your neighborhood if anyone has used their services before. Suppose they have a lot of negative reviews. In that case, it may be best to look elsewhere for residential electrical contractors who can provide quality work and great customer service at an affordable price point.

The last thing you want is to get stuck with subpar work because the residential electricians didn’t know what they were doing.

If there are no reviews available on Yelp, Google Reviews, or Angie’s List, that’s not a good sign. Try to find another contractor who has more positive reviews.
